Benchtop Autoclave FM-BA-B200 have a chamber capacity of 20L, ensures quick and controlled sterilization with customizable temperature and time settings. Its compact structure keeps the environment dry and contamination-free. Over-pressure and over-temperature protection enhances user safety during each cycle. A corrosion-resistant stainless steel chamber boosts durability and hygiene. Ideal for medical clinics, dental practices, laboratories, and research facilities.

Benchtop Autoclave FM-BA-B200 is a reliable, safe and automatically controlled sterilizer for medical health, pharmaceutical, and scientific research. It carries out quick sterilization for saturated steam-resistant articles, including surgery, dentistry, glassware, medicines, culture medium, fabric dressings, and food.
Fison benchtop autoclave range designed for compact steam sterilization in laboratories and dental environments, suitable for sterilizing culture media, solvents, glassware and pipette tips. As an autoclave sterilizer, the series operates with a working temperature up to 134°C and a working pressure of 0.22 MPa, supported by thermo-pressure control, digital display, safety lock system and alarm functions. Available chamber capacities range from 8 L to 80 L, including Class B models with vacuum support, recording accuracy up to ±0.5°C, and chamber dimensions up to Ø386 × 700 mm, ensuring efficient sterilization performance across varied laboratory requirements.
